Genetic engineering courses can help you learn gene editing techniques, DNA sequencing, and the principles of synthetic biology. You can build skills in designing experiments, analyzing genetic data, and applying CRISPR technology for various applications. Many courses introduce tools like bioinformatics software and laboratory equipment, that support conducting research and developing genetically modified organisms.
